A Method with History and Reliability
Bank transfers have been part of the online gambling world since the very beginning. When the first online casinos appeared in the 1990s, direct transfers from a player’s bank account were often the only way to move funds. Today, the options are far more diverse, but the traditional bank transfer has held its ground thanks to its familiarity and the strong regulatory framework behind it.
When you make a bank transfer, the money moves directly from your checking or savings account to the casino’s account. There are no third-party apps or digital wallets involved. This direct connection gives players a sense of control and security — especially those who prefer to keep their gambling funds separate from other online transactions.
Advantages: Security and Transparency
The biggest advantage of using a bank transfer is security. Your transaction is handled by your own bank, which operates under strict U.S. financial regulations and data protection laws. This means your personal and financial information is safeguarded by one of the most secure systems available.
Bank transfers are also highly transparent. You can track every step of the transaction through your online banking portal, and there are no hidden fees or unclear processes. For players who like to keep detailed records of their deposits and withdrawals, this level of clarity is invaluable.
Another key benefit is that many online casinos prefer to use bank transfers for larger withdrawals. This ensures proper identity verification and compliance with anti-money laundering regulations — something that’s especially important for U.S. players using licensed and regulated casino sites.
Disadvantages: Patience Required
The main drawback of bank transfers is speed. While e-wallets and instant payment methods can process transactions in seconds, a bank transfer can take anywhere from one to five business days, depending on your bank and the casino’s processing time.
Some banks may also charge small fees for wire transfers, particularly if the casino operates internationally. It’s always a good idea to check both your bank’s and the casino’s terms before initiating a transfer.
How to Make a Bank Transfer to an Online Casino
The process is straightforward, though it requires a bit more patience than modern payment methods:
- Log in to your casino account and go to the deposit section.
- Select “Bank Transfer” as your payment method.
- Note the casino’s banking details, which may include routing and account numbers or wire transfer instructions.
- Log in to your online banking and set up the transfer to the casino’s account.
- Include your player ID or reference code so the casino can match your payment.
- Wait for confirmation — your funds should appear in your casino balance within a few business days.
Withdrawals work in much the same way. While they may take a little longer to process, they’re among the most secure ways to receive your winnings.
